﻿/*For Body text*/
.bodytext
{
	font-family:Arial;
	font-size:12px ;
	font-style: normal;
	font-weight: normal;
	color: #333333;
	text-decoration: none;
	text-align:justify;
}

/*For Content page heading*/
.heading
{
	font-family:Arial;
	font-size:13px ;
	font-style: normal;
	font-weight:bold;
	color:  #951803;
	text-decoration: none;
	text-align:justify;
}
/*For Content page heading
.heading
{
	font-family:Arial;
	font-size:12px ;
	font-style: normal;
	font-weight:bold;
	color: #333333;
	text-decoration: none;
	text-align:justify;
}
*/
/*For Content page heading*/
.subheading
{
	font-family:Arial;
	font-size:12px ;
	font-style: normal;
	font-weight:bold;
	color:  #951803;
	text-decoration: none;
	text-align:justify;
}
/*To make text bold*/
.boldtext
{
	font-family:Arial;
	font-size:13px ;
	font-style: normal;
	font-weight:bold;
	color:  #000000;
	text-decoration: none;
	text-align:justify;
	
}

/* for Heading*/
.heading1
{
	font-family:Georgia;
	font-size:20px ;
	font-style: normal;
	font-weight: normal;
	color: #ffffff;
	text-decoration: none;
	text-align:left;
	
}
/*For text below heading1*/
.heading2
{
	font-family:Georgia ;
	font-size:13px ;
	font-style: normal;
	font-weight: normal;
	color:#ffffff ;
	text-decoration: none;
	text-align:justify;
	
}
/*Homepagelink below heading1*/
.hometextlink
{
	font-family:Arial ;
	font-size:12px;
	font-style: normal;
	color:Black;
	text-decoration:none;
	
}
.hometextlink:hover
{
	font-family:Arial ;
	font-size:12px;
	font-style: normal;
	color: #1350A1;
	text-decoration: none;	
}
/*Hyperlink for homepagenew*/
.homelink
{
	font-family:Arial ;
	font-size:12px;
	font-style: normal;
	color:Black;
	text-decoration:none;
	
}
.homelink:hover
{
	font-family:Arial ;
	font-size:12px;
	font-style: normal;
	color:#990000;
	text-decoration: none;	
}

/*Hyperlink for CAREER text at homepagenew*/
.careerlink
{
	font-family:Arial ;
	font-size:12px;
	font-style: normal;
	color:Black;
	font-weight:bold;
	text-decoration:none;
	
}
.careerlink:hover
{
	font-family:Arial ;
	font-size:12px;
	font-style: normal;
	color:#663300;
	font-weight:bold;
	text-decoration: none;	
}
/*Hyperlink below heading1*/
.hyperlink
{
	font-family:Arial ;
	font-size:12px;
	font-style: normal;
	font-weight:bold;
	color:Black;
	text-decoration:none;
	
}
.hyperlink:hover
{
	font-family:Arial ;
	font-size:12px;
	font-style: normal;
	font-weight:bold;
	color: #0033cc;
	text-decoration: none;	
}
/*Hyperlink for TabControl*/
.tabhyperlink
{
	font-family:Arial ;
	font-size:11px;
	font-style: normal;
	font-weight:bold;
	color:Black;
	text-decoration:none;
	
}
.tabhyperlink:hover
{
	font-family:Arial ;
	font-size:11px;
	font-style: normal;
	font-weight:bold;
	color: #0033cc;
	text-decoration: none;
	
}
/*Text for TabControl(Spotlight)*/
.tabtext
{
	font-family:Arial ;
	font-size:11px;
	font-style: normal;
	font-weight:bold;
	color:Black;
	text-decoration:none;
	
}


/*for bodytext heading*/
.bodyheading
{
	font-family:Arial;
	font-size:14px ;
	font-style: normal;
	font-weight: bold;
	color: #003399;
	text-decoration: none;
	text-align:left;
	
}
/*To make text bold*/
.boldtext
{
	font-family:Arial;
	font-size:13px ;
	font-style: normal;
	font-weight:bold;
	color:  #000000;
	text-decoration: none;
	text-align:justify;	
}

/*for Breadcrumb*/
.breadcrumb
{
	font-family:Arial ;
	font-size:11px;
	font-style: normal;
	font-weight: normal;
	color:#000000 ;
	text-decoration: none;
	text-align:left;
}

.breadcrumb:hover
{
	font-family: Arial;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color:#860c0c ;
	text-decoration: none;
	text-align:left;
}


/*next to breadcrumb*/
.heretext
{
font-family: Arial;
font-size: 11px;
font-weight: normal;
color:#993300 ;
text-decoration: none;
text-align:left;
}

/*for right menu*/
.right_menu
{
	font-family:Arial ;
	font-size:12px ;
	font-style:normal;
	font-weight: bold;
	color:#003399 ;
	text-decoration: none;
	text-align:left;
}

.right_menu:hover
{
	font-family:Arial ;
	font-size:12px ;
	font-style: normal;
	font-weight: bold;
	color: #660000;
	text-decoration: none;
	text-align:left;
}
/*For bottom(legal notices)*/
.bottomtxt
{
	font-family: Arial;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#ff6600;
	text-decoration: none;
	
}
.bottomtxt1
{
	font-family: Arial;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#0a57bf;
	text-decoration: none;
	
}
.bottomtxt:hover
{
	font-family: Arial;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#0a57bf;
	text-decoration: none;
	
}
/*Searchbox*/
.searchbox
{
	font-family: Arial;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	color: #ff6600;
	text-decoration: none;
	background-color: #ffffff;
	text-align:left;	
	width:70px;
	height:15px;
}
/*For updates below copyright*/
.updates
{
color:#044194;
font-family:Verdana;
font-size:10px;
font-style: normal;
font-weight: normal;
}


.right_menu_image
{
	font-family:Arial;
	font-size:14px;
	font-weight:bold;
	color:#003399;
	text-align:center;
}

/*For button at Cdac.master*/
.buttonmaster
{
	background-color:Transparent;
	border-style:none;
	font-weight:bold;
	color:White;
}

/*For Menu's at the top */
.topmenu
{
	border-top-style:none;
	border-right-style:none;
	border-left-style:none;
	border-bottom-style:none;
}

/* For Labels*/
.label
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color:Maroon;
	text-decoration: none;
	font-weight: bold ;
}
/*.label
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color:#ffffff;
	text-decoration: none;
	font-weight: bold ;
}*/
/* For textbox's */
.textbox {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	text-decoration: none;
	font-weight: normal ;
}
  
   /* For error message */
.error {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color:Red;
	text-decoration: none;
	font-weight: bold ;
}    
/* Button*/    
.button {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
    font-weight: bold ;
	color: #003399;
	text-decoration:none;
	background-color:#e2f0fd;
    }

.body1
{
	list-style-image:url("designimages/sitemap_bullet-1.gif");
}
/*CSS for Last Update text below copyright*/


/************************************/
/*For Tab control at Home page*/
.shadetabs{
padding: 8px 0px;
margin-left: 0;
margin-right:0px;
margin-top: 1px;
margin-bottom: 0;
font: bold 12px Verdana;
list-style-type: none;
text-align: left; 
height:30px;
border-bottom-style:none;/*set to left, center, or right to align the menu as desired*/

}

.shadetabs li{
display: inline;
margin: 0;
height:30px;
}

.shadetabs li a{
text-decoration: none;
padding: 5px 5px 8px 0px;
margin-right: 0px;
border: 1px solid;
border-bottom-color:Orange;
border-left-color:#cccccc;
border-right-color:#cccccc;
border-top-color:#cccccc;
color: #2d2b2b;
background: white url(designimages/shade.gif) top left repeat-x;

}

.shadetabs li a:visited{
color: #2d2b2b;

}

.shadetabs li a:hover{
text-decoration:none;
color: #2d2b2b;

}

.shadetabs li.selected{
position:relative;
top: 1px;

}

.shadetabs li.selected a{ /*selected main tab style */
background-image: url(designimages/shadeactive.gif);
border-bottom-color: white;

}

.shadetabs li.selected a:hover{ /*selected main tab style */
text-decoration: none;
}

.tabcontentstyle{ /*style of tab content oontainer*/
border: 1px solid gray;
width: 450px;
margin-bottom: 1em;
padding: 10px;
background-color:#f5f9fc;
}

.tabcontent
{
display:none;

}

@media print {
.tabcontent {
display:block!important;

}
}
/*end of css for tab control at home page*/

 #logindiv
    {
		background-image : url(../../designimages/logincms_bg.jpg); 
		width:500px;
		height:350px;
		vertical-align:middle;
	}
	.cmsloginbtn
	{
		
	}
	.cmsloginbtn:hover
	{
		list-style-image: url(../../designimages/loginbtn_over.gif);
	}
	
	
	
	
	
	/**********************************Home Page CSS***************************************/
	.toplinks{
font-family:"Arial","Helvetica", "sans-serif";
font-size:11px;
font-weight:normal;
color:#FFFFFF;
margin:5px;
text-align:right;
vertical-align:middle;
margin:5px;
margin-right:10px;
}

.top_body{
font-family:"Arial", "Helvetica", "sans-serif";
font-size:12px;
font-weight:normal;
color:#000000;
text-align:justify;
margin:10px;
}

.top_Story:{
font-family:"Times New Roman", "Times", "serif";
font-size:15px;
font-weight:bold;
color:#000000;
text-align:left;
}

.topStory_story{
font-family:"Times New Roman", "Times", "serif";
font-size:15px;
font-weight:normal;
color:#000000;
}

.headings{
font-family:"Arial", "Helvetica", "sans-serif";
font-size:14px;
font-weight:bold;
font-style:normal;
color:#003399;
text-align:left;
}

.points{
font-family:"Arial", "Helvetica", "sans-serif";
font-size:12px;
font-weight:normal;
font-style:normal;
color:#000000;
text-align:left;
}

.footer{
font-family:"Arial", "Helvetica", "sans-serif";
font-size:11px;
font-weight:normal;
color:#000000;
text-align:center;
}
	
	
	
	/**********************************End of Home Page CSS********************************/
	
	
    /*****************************************************************/    
        /******************Photogallery*****************************/
        #lightbox{
	background-color:#eee;
	padding: 10px;
	border-bottom: 2px solid #666;
	border-right: 2px solid #666;
	}

#lightboxDetails{
	font-size: 0.8em;
	padding-top: 0.4em;
	}	
#lightboxCaption{ float: left; }
#keyboardMsg{ float: right; }

#lightbox img{ border: none; } 
#overlay img{ border: none; }

#overlay{ background-image: url(../../designimages/overlay.png); }

* html #overlay{
	background-color: #000;
	background-color: transparent;
	/*background-image: url(blank.gif);
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src="designimages/overlay.png", sizingMethod="scale");*/
	}
	
	
	/*****************************************************************/